    ENO Underbelly Gear Sling ???

    Newbie here. I was just curious, does anybody use the ENO Underbelly Gear Sling (or similar product from other manufacture) for gear or pack storage? It seems like a decent idea to keep your gear or pack off the ground, but didn't know if it was practical and was curious if anybody actually ever uses something like this or not. If not, do you have a preferred method of keeping your pack off the ground? Thanks!

    I've got the ENO gear sling --- and have used it not so much to keep my pack off the ground but to keep items like my Kindle, glasses case, waterbottle, socks, etc. within easy reach from the inside the hammock and inside my bugnet. Previously I was trying to keep all of this stuff in the hammock with me --- which was a royal pain.
    In hindsight - I'd probably opt for the sling/chair from dutch or a hammock chair instead - as it would serve more than one purpose...but I was really new then and didn't know any better.
    Keep in mind, the gear sling will only hold about 50 lbs ---
